ADR3433ARJZAlternatives & Equivalent Parts
About ADR3433ARJZ
ADR3433ARJZ is a Integrated Circuit component manufactured by Analog Devices. It comes in a SOT23 (6-Pin) package. Below you'll find known alternative and equivalent parts that can serve as replacements in your design.

Why Look for Alternatives?
Finding alternatives for ADR3433ARJZ is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.
When evaluating ADR3433ARJZ replacements, consider key parameters such as package compatibility, electrical specifications, and operating temperature range. Our engineering team can help verify pin-to-pin compatibility for your specific application.
